Dual batteries
Hey guys.
When i go camping i like to sleep inside my jeep. Last i went to king of the hammers race and it was like 30 degrees outside and i had to run my jeep and burn a quarter tank of gas to be able to sleep.
I would like to eliminate that and run a 2nd battery. The problem is i do not know where to locate it.
I currently sleep on the back seat but i want to start sleeping with the back seat down because its getting uncomfortable.
Any pictures or ideas would be greatly appreciated.
